Output 0850d8527d4861c908c332c0768b24b7985c339d68493a640c26f493164ff26d:17

value
172116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ce2e29e7248900d942b2b0ade66560457a9d670 OP_EQUAL
address
37ExGKGQCjNEQUnqsZM2H8mWtoj8V6YuQC
transaction
0850d8527d4861c908c332c0768b24b7985c339d68493a640c26f493164ff26d
spent
true